**When you come in to work**
You will be working closely with a diverse, enthusiastic, and talented team as part of a growing Marketplace Department. You will assist with the management of our portfolio of products across our UK marketplace channels including Amazon, eBay, and others.This is an exciting opportunity for someone passionate about ecommerce and marketplace to have exposure to how we manage our UK accounts, drive sales and monitor KPIs. You’ll work closely with our Marketplace Executive and UK Marketplace Manager, as well asthe broader team, and there will be opportunity to learn quickly and take on responsibility from an early stage. This role would be ideal either for your first role within a business, or your first role in this industry, where you can use transferrable skillssuch as analysis and commercial acumen, as well as an entrepreneurial spirit. You don’t need experience in an identical role - just a keenness to learn and drive sales in a marketplace setting.
In your role, you will assist with:

- Managing a portfolio of products on Amazon.co.uk for one of Amazon’s largest and fastest growing sellers, including but not limited to:

- Utilising and analysing all available data to identify sales/product/category trends and creation and implementation of strategies to maximise product performance
- Creating, managing, and optimising a number of Amazon PPC advertising campaigns
- Swiftly integrating and improving the performance of newly acquired brands whilst also developing and implementing both a short and long-term brand strategy
- Effectively launching new products into competitive niches whilst ensuring sales and profitability targets are achieved
- Conducting competitor analysis, understanding market dynamics to define pricing strategy
- Writing keyword optimised copy for both new and existing product listings
- Briefing the design team to create/enhance images and content
- Managing special offers, sales and major deal campaigns including Prime Day and Black Friday
- Management of other online marketplaces including eBay with the opportunity to drive our growth onto new marketplaces.
